The Science Behind “No Jamming”: Shine’s Engineering Excellence

Veneer jamming in dryers typically stems from mechanical instability, uneven roller alignment, or poor airflow design. Shine Machinery’s veneer drying machines are built to eliminate these risks through four key technical innovations:

  1. High-Temperature Stainless Steel Bearings for Smooth Operation
    The heart of any roller dryer lies in its bearings. Shine uses high-temperature stainless steel bearings—engineered to withstand the heat and friction of continuous drying. These bearings ensure the rollers rotate with minimal vibration or deviation, keeping veneer sheets moving steadily through the dryer without binding or sticking.

  2. Precision-Machined Rollers: Straightness & Roundness Redefined
    Roller alignment is critical. Shine’s rollers are crafted from high-precision shaft tubes with strict dimensional controls:

    • Straightness: ≤50mm over the entire length, ensuring rollers remain perfectly aligned.

    • Ellipticity: ≤10mm, preventing uneven surface contact that could trap veneer.
      This precision minimizes micro-movements, guaranteeing a consistent, jam-free passage for every veneer sheet.

  3. Trapezoidal-Angle Guide Air Ducts with Serrated Design
    Poor airflow is a major culprit behind veneer jamming. Shine’s dryers feature trapezoidal-angle guide air ducts that direct hot air evenly across the veneer surface. Paired with a serrated design on duct edges, this structure disrupts airflow stagnation and prevents debris or veneer fragments from accumulating—eliminating blockages at the source.

  4. Stringent Installation: Leveling for Unwavering Stability
    Even the best engineering can falter without proper installation. Shine’s team adheres to strict leveling protocols during setup, ensuring the entire dryer frame sits within a tight horizontal tolerance. This stability prevents roller misalignment over time, maintaining smooth veneer transport throughout the drying cycle.
